  5. Major League Soccer on television -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Major_League_Soccer_on...

    Major League Soccer has been broadcast live in the United States nationally since the league's inception in 1996 and in Canada since 2007. [1] As of the 2023 season, Apple Inc. is the primary global rights holder and streams every regular season and playoff match on MLS Season Pass – a service in the Apple TV app.

  7. Workouts (Apple) -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Workouts_(Apple)

    Workouts is a fitness companion and activity recording application developed by Apple Inc. for Apple Watch devices, used to start workout tracking and view metrics while an exercise activity is in progress. The app was first introduced alongside watchOS 1 on April 24, 2015, and is tightly integrated into the operating system's health tracking ...

  9. High-performance sport -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/High-performance_sport

    High performance sport or elite sport is sport at the highest level of competition. In sports administration , "high-performance sport", where the emphasis is on winning prestigious competitions, is distinguished from " mass sport " or " recreational sport", where the emphasis is on attracting the maximum number of participants.
